Dogecoin, often referred to as the "dogecoin meme coin," is a decentralized, open-source cryptocurrency that has captured the hearts of individuals worldwide. Launched in 2013 as a satirical take on the then-popular cryptocurrency Bitcoin, Dogecoin has evolved into a vibrant community with a dedicated following known as "Dogecoiners."

The defining characteristic of Dogecoin is its Shiba Inu mascot, a breed of Japanese dog. This playful and approachable image has made Dogecoin highly relatable and appealing to individuals seeking an alternative to the more serious and technical cryptocurrency landscape.

Despite its humble beginnings as a joke, Dogecoin has gained significant traction in recent years. Its loyal community has fueled its growth, and the cryptocurrency has achieved notable milestones. In 2021, Dogecoin experienced a surge in popularity, reaching an all-time high value of over $0.70 per coin. This surge was largely driven by enthusiastic support from public figures such as Elon Musk, who repeatedly endorsed Dogecoin on social media.

While Dogecoin's value has fluctuated significantly since its peak, it remains a popular choice for cryptocurrency enthusiasts. Its strong community and active development team continue to work towards expanding its functionality and adoption. One of the key areas of focus is developing Dogecoin's use cases beyond mere speculation and investment.

In an effort to enhance its utility, Dogecoin has been integrated into various online platforms and services. It can now be used for online purchases, donations, and even tipping content creators on social media. Additionally, the Dogecoin Foundation has launched initiatives to promote charitable causes and support organizations aligned with the cryptocurrency's values.
